Guest Post Promotion: Driving Traffic Back to Your Site
You've successfully landed a guest post on a reputable blog in your industry. Congratulations! This is a huge win for your brand's authority and your SEO. But your work isn't over once the post is published.
To get the maximum possible value out of your guest post, you need to be proactive in promoting it.
Promoting your guest post helps you to achieve two key goals:
- It drives referral traffic: It sends engaged readers from the host blog back to your own website.
- It increases the authority of the guest post itself: A post that gets a lot of traffic and social shares is seen as a more valuable asset, which can increase the value of the backlink it contains.
Here's how to effectively promote your guest post.
1. Thank the Host and Share it with Your Audience
This is the first and most important step.
- Share it on Your Social Media Channels: As soon as the post goes live, share it across all of your social media profiles. Be sure to tag the host blog in your post. This is a great way to show your appreciation and to get them to re-share it with their own audience.
- Send it to Your Email List: Let your email subscribers know about your new guest post. This is a great way to send an initial surge of traffic to the post and to show the host blog that you are a valuable partner who can bring them new readers.
2. Add it to Your Website
Your own website is a great place to showcase your guest post.
- Create a "Featured On" or "Press" Page: If you don't already have one, create a page on your site where you list the authoritative places where your brand has been featured. Add a link to your new guest post here.
- Link to it from Relevant Blog Posts: Go back to some of your existing blog posts and find a relevant place to add an internal link to your guest post.
3. Engage with the Comments
For the first few days after the guest post is published, make a point to monitor the comments section.
- Respond to Every Comment: If people are taking the time to comment on your article, you should take the time to respond to them.
- Why it matters: This shows that you are an engaged and helpful expert, and it can help to build a relationship with the host blog's audience. It also keeps the conversation going, which can increase the post's visibility.
4. Repurpose the Content
You can repurpose the ideas from your guest post into other formats to be shared on different channels.
- Create a Short Video: Create a short video that summarizes the key points of your guest post and share it on YouTube and social media, with a link to the full article.
- Create an Infographic: If your post is data-heavy, you could create an infographic and share it on Pinterest.
5. Consider a Small Paid Promotion Budget
If the guest post is on a very high-authority site and is a major win for your brand, you can consider putting a small paid advertising budget behind it.
- How it works: You can run a Facebook or LinkedIn ad campaign that drives traffic directly to the guest post on the host's site.
- Why it works: This can dramatically increase the number of people who see your content and your brand on a highly credible, third-party platform. It also makes you look like a fantastic partner to the host blog.
Conclusion
Getting a guest post published is a great achievement, but the value you get from it is directly related to the effort you put into promoting it. By treating your guest post with the same level of promotional energy as you would your own content, you can maximize your referral traffic, strengthen your relationship with the host blog, and increase the overall SEO value of your link building efforts.
